Zenith Bookstore opens July 1 in West Duluth

A year-long quest to launch a shop selling new and “gently used” books is almost complete. Zenith Bookstore will open for business July 1 in the former Wild West Liquor building at 318 N. Central Ave. in West Duluth. Perfect Duluth Day first reported about the store’s development in September.

The inventory of 20,000 books includes genres ranging from children’s literature to regional works. A selection of greeting cards, toys, journals and other book-related items will also be available. Hours will be Tuesdays through Saturdays from 10 a.m. to 7 p.m. Special events such as children’s hour, author signings, and readings will be held in the space. A grand opening event is being planned for September.

The 19th Century brick building has been extensively remodeled since Bob and Angel Dobrow purchased it nearly a year ago. It features hardwood floors, a reading area and a literary-themed mural by local artist Tom Napoli showcasing the storefront.

The Dobrows recently moved to Duluth from Northfield. Bob is retiring from 20 years of teaching math and statistics at Carleton College. Angel is active in the sustainability movement, and plans to start an herbal practice in the Twin Ports.
